Product Overview
The FG 856-014SC round end taper diamond burs are engineered by House Brand Dentistry to meet the demanding needs of professional dental practitioners and laboratory technicians. These burs feature a super coarse grit diamond coating that enables rapid removal of tooth structure, making them especially suitable for heavy‑cut procedures such as crown preparation, bridge work, and extensive restorative shaping. Each bur is crafted from high‑grade stainless steel, providing a robust core that resists flexing and maintains dimensional stability under high torque conditions. The round end taper design offers a smooth transition from the tip to the shank, allowing for precise control and reduced vibration during operation. Packaged in a convenient set of ten, the burs are sterilizable, autoclavable, and ready for immediate use in any standard dental handpiece.

Usage
These diamond burs excel in a variety of clinical and laboratory environments. In a dental clinic, they are ideal for fast tooth reduction when preparing large occlusal surfaces or when working with patients who have limited tolerance for lengthy procedures. Their super coarse grit ensures that the operator can achieve the desired reduction in fewer passes, reducing chair‑time and improving patient comfort. In a dental laboratory, the burs provide consistent performance for technicians fabricating prosthetic components, allowing for uniform shaping of metal or ceramic frameworks. The round end taper geometry also makes them suitable for teaching scenarios, where dental students can practice controlled cutting techniques while experiencing the feedback of a high‑quality instrument. Compatibility with standard high‑speed handpieces ensures seamless integration into existing workflows.

FAQ
What is the recommended handpiece speed for these burs?
For optimal performance, use a high‑speed handpiece operating between 300,000 and 400,000 RPM. This range maximizes the efficiency of the super coarse grit while maintaining control and safety.
Can these burs be used on both metal and ceramic materials?
Yes, the diamond coating is suitable for shaping metal alloys, zirconia, and other high‑strength ceramics. The coarse grit allows for rapid removal while preserving the integrity of the underlying material.
How should the burs be cleaned and maintained?
After each use, rinse the burs under running water to remove debris, then place them in an ultrasonic cleaner for thorough cleaning. Autoclave sterilization is recommended to ensure infection control and to maintain sharpness.
Are the burs compatible with all standard dental handpieces?
These burs are designed to fit standard high‑speed handpieces with a 1.8 mm shank diameter, making them compatible with the majority of dental equipment on the market.
